SpawnWP is a free and open-source, self-hosted WordPress development lab for creating isolated, disposable WordPress environments on your own Debian or Ubuntu server.
It is designed for development, testing, debugging, plugin/theme evaluation, demos and experimentation โ not as a traditional hosting control panel.
Each WordPress instance runs in its own isolated Docker stack and can be created, reset, snapshotted or destroyed whenever needed. SpawnWP also includes a web-based cockpit for managing environments without having to work exclusively from the command line.

Unlike hosted services such as InstaWP or TasteWP, SpawnWP runs entirely on infrastructure you control. There are no per-site fees, artificial site limits or recurring SaaS subscriptions imposed by SpawnWP itself โ your limits are essentially the resources available on your server.
SpawnWP started as a personal tool for quickly spinning up WordPress test environments and was later released publicly as an MIT-licensed open-source project.
It is particularly useful for WordPress developers, agencies, plugin and theme authors, QA testers and anyone who frequently needs clean WordPress installations without repeatedly configuring servers from scratch.

The site is a Hugo static build. HTML, CSS, a bit of vanilla JS. Push to main, a GitHub Action runs hugo --minify, and the result lands on GitHub Pages. No server to babysit. - Source: dev.to / about 2 months ago

PaperMod is a clean, fast Hugo theme. What it doesn't give you out of the box is a component library: no callouts, no numbered steps, no before/after comparisons. If you write tutorials or technical posts, you end up compensating with blockquotes and bold text where purpose-built components would serve the reader better. - Source: dev.to / 4 months ago
